18c339a94Sopenharmony_ciLanguage:        Cpp
28c339a94Sopenharmony_ciBasedOnStyle:  Google
38c339a94Sopenharmony_ciAccessModifierOffset: -4
48c339a94Sopenharmony_ciAlignAfterOpenBracket: Align
58c339a94Sopenharmony_ciAlignConsecutiveAssignments: false
68c339a94Sopenharmony_ciAlignConsecutiveDeclarations: false
78c339a94Sopenharmony_ciAlignEscapedNewlines: Left
88c339a94Sopenharmony_ciAlignOperands:   true
98c339a94Sopenharmony_ciAlignTrailingComments: true
108c339a94Sopenharmony_ciAllowAllParametersOfDeclarationOnNextLine: true
118c339a94Sopenharmony_ciAllowShortBlocksOnASingleLine: false
128c339a94Sopenharmony_ciAllowShortCaseLabelsOnASingleLine: false
138c339a94Sopenharmony_ciAllowShortFunctionsOnASingleLine: Empty
148c339a94Sopenharmony_ciAllowShortIfStatementsOnASingleLine: false
158c339a94Sopenharmony_ciAllowShortLoopsOnASingleLine: false
168c339a94Sopenharmony_ciAlwaysBreakAfterDefinitionReturnType: None
178c339a94Sopenharmony_ciAlwaysBreakAfterReturnType: None
188c339a94Sopenharmony_ciAlwaysBreakBeforeMultilineStrings: true
198c339a94Sopenharmony_ciAlwaysBreakTemplateDeclarations: true
208c339a94Sopenharmony_ciBinPackArguments: true
218c339a94Sopenharmony_ciBinPackParameters: true
228c339a94Sopenharmony_ciBraceWrapping:   
238c339a94Sopenharmony_ci  AfterClass:      false
248c339a94Sopenharmony_ci  AfterControlStatement: false
258c339a94Sopenharmony_ci  AfterEnum:       false
268c339a94Sopenharmony_ci  AfterFunction:   true
278c339a94Sopenharmony_ci  AfterNamespace:  false
288c339a94Sopenharmony_ci  AfterObjCDeclaration: false
298c339a94Sopenharmony_ci  AfterStruct:     false
308c339a94Sopenharmony_ci  AfterUnion:      false
318c339a94Sopenharmony_ci  AfterExternBlock: false
328c339a94Sopenharmony_ci  BeforeCatch:     false
338c339a94Sopenharmony_ci  BeforeElse:      false
348c339a94Sopenharmony_ci  IndentBraces:    false
358c339a94Sopenharmony_ci  SplitEmptyFunction: true
368c339a94Sopenharmony_ci  SplitEmptyRecord: true
378c339a94Sopenharmony_ci  SplitEmptyNamespace: true
388c339a94Sopenharmony_ciBreakBeforeBinaryOperators: None
398c339a94Sopenharmony_ciBreakBeforeBraces: Custom
408c339a94Sopenharmony_ciBreakBeforeInheritanceComma: false
418c339a94Sopenharmony_ciBreakBeforeTernaryOperators: true
428c339a94Sopenharmony_ciBreakConstructorInitializersBeforeComma: false
438c339a94Sopenharmony_ciBreakConstructorInitializers: BeforeColon
448c339a94Sopenharmony_ciBreakAfterJavaFieldAnnotations: false
458c339a94Sopenharmony_ciBreakStringLiterals: true
468c339a94Sopenharmony_ciColumnLimit:     120
478c339a94Sopenharmony_ciCommentPragmas:  '^ IWYU pragma:'
488c339a94Sopenharmony_ciCompactNamespaces: false
498c339a94Sopenharmony_ciConstructorInitializerAllOnOneLineOrOnePerLine: true
508c339a94Sopenharmony_ciConstructorInitializerIndentWidth: 4
518c339a94Sopenharmony_ciContinuationIndentWidth: 4
528c339a94Sopenharmony_ciCpp11BracedListStyle: true
538c339a94Sopenharmony_ciDerivePointerAlignment: false
548c339a94Sopenharmony_ciDisableFormat:   false
558c339a94Sopenharmony_ciExperimentalAutoDetectBinPacking: false
568c339a94Sopenharmony_ciFixNamespaceComments: true
578c339a94Sopenharmony_ciForEachMacros:   
588c339a94Sopenharmony_ci  - foreach
598c339a94Sopenharmony_ci  - Q_FOREACH
608c339a94Sopenharmony_ci  - BOOST_FOREACH
618c339a94Sopenharmony_ciIncludeBlocks:   Regroup
628c339a94Sopenharmony_ciIncludeCategories: 
638c339a94Sopenharmony_ci  - Regex:           '^<ext/.*\.h>'
648c339a94Sopenharmony_ci    Priority:        2
658c339a94Sopenharmony_ci  - Regex:           '^<.*\.h>'
668c339a94Sopenharmony_ci    Priority:        1
678c339a94Sopenharmony_ci  - Regex:           '^<.*'
688c339a94Sopenharmony_ci    Priority:        2
698c339a94Sopenharmony_ci  - Regex:           '.*'
708c339a94Sopenharmony_ci    Priority:        3
718c339a94Sopenharmony_ciIncludeIsMainRegex: '([-_](test|unittest))?$'
728c339a94Sopenharmony_ciIndentCaseLabels: true
738c339a94Sopenharmony_ciIndentPPDirectives: None
748c339a94Sopenharmony_ciIndentWidth:     4
758c339a94Sopenharmony_ciIndentWrappedFunctionNames: false
768c339a94Sopenharmony_ciJavaScriptQuotes: Leave
778c339a94Sopenharmony_ciJavaScriptWrapImports: true
788c339a94Sopenharmony_ciKeepEmptyLinesAtTheStartOfBlocks: false
798c339a94Sopenharmony_ciMacroBlockBegin: ''
808c339a94Sopenharmony_ciMacroBlockEnd:   ''
818c339a94Sopenharmony_ciMaxEmptyLinesToKeep: 1
828c339a94Sopenharmony_ciNamespaceIndentation: None
838c339a94Sopenharmony_ciObjCBlockIndentWidth: 4
848c339a94Sopenharmony_ciObjCSpaceAfterProperty: false
858c339a94Sopenharmony_ciObjCSpaceBeforeProtocolList: true
868c339a94Sopenharmony_ciPenaltyBreakAssignment: 2
878c339a94Sopenharmony_ciPenaltyBreakBeforeFirstCallParameter: 19
888c339a94Sopenharmony_ciPenaltyBreakComment: 300
898c339a94Sopenharmony_ciPenaltyBreakFirstLessLess: 120
908c339a94Sopenharmony_ciPenaltyBreakString: 1000
918c339a94Sopenharmony_ciPenaltyExcessCharacter: 1000000
928c339a94Sopenharmony_ciPenaltyReturnTypeOnItsOwnLine: 200
938c339a94Sopenharmony_ciPointerAlignment: Right
948c339a94Sopenharmony_ciReflowComments:  true
958c339a94Sopenharmony_ciSortIncludes:    false
968c339a94Sopenharmony_ciSortUsingDeclarations: true
978c339a94Sopenharmony_ciSpaceAfterCStyleCast: false
988c339a94Sopenharmony_ciSpaceAfterTemplateKeyword: true
998c339a94Sopenharmony_ciSpaceBeforeAssignmentOperators: true
1008c339a94Sopenharmony_ciSpaceBeforeCpp11BracedList: true
1018c339a94Sopenharmony_ciSpaceBeforeParens: ControlStatements
1028c339a94Sopenharmony_ciSpaceInEmptyParentheses: false
1038c339a94Sopenharmony_ciSpacesBeforeTrailingComments: 2
1048c339a94Sopenharmony_ciSpacesInAngles:  false
1058c339a94Sopenharmony_ciSpacesInContainerLiterals: false
1068c339a94Sopenharmony_ciSpacesInCStyleCastParentheses: false
1078c339a94Sopenharmony_ciSpacesInParentheses: false
1088c339a94Sopenharmony_ciSpacesInSquareBrackets: false
1098c339a94Sopenharmony_ciStandard:        Cpp11
1108c339a94Sopenharmony_ciTabWidth:        4
1118c339a94Sopenharmony_ciUseTab:          Never